The success of hard rock drilling heavily depends on selecting the right equipment:
Drilling Machines for Hard Rock: These machines are specifically designed to penetrate dense rock layers with high precision and efficiency.
Anchor Bolt Drilling Rigs: These rigs provide stability in underground environments, ensuring the safety of drilling operations.
Exploration Coring Drill Rigs: Used for obtaining core samples, these rigs are essential for analyzing rock composition and identifying mineral deposits.
Drilling through hard rock requires specialized techniques to optimize efficiency and reduce wear and tear:
Rotary Drilling: A high-torque method that uses a rotating drill bit to grind through rock.
Percussive Drilling: Combines impact and rotation to break through dense rock formations.
Diamond Core Drilling: Utilizes diamond-tipped drill bits for precision drilling in hard rock, ensuring minimal material loss.
Drilling through hard rock poses various challenges, including equipment wear, heat generation, and vibration:
Heat Management: Using water or air for cooling prevents overheating of equipment.
Vibration Control: Advanced stabilizers and shock absorbers minimize vibration, ensuring accurate drilling.
Maintenance Practices: Regular maintenance of drilling machines and rigs reduces downtime and prolongs equipment life.
